Anyways. If you wanted to be the absolute lightest weight possible for your height and still have a healthy 'bmi', yes, 120 (actually 118 but same diff) would be your weight. But the point is - you don't need to have a 'bmi' of 18.5. At your height, anything below 160 is theoretically in the normal range. However, don't go by BMI. It doesn't take into account muscle or build or anything. My mom is small boned, and I'm slightly larger boned, but we weigh close to the same just due to bones and stuff. She's 6-7 inches taller than me too, yet we look similar. If you're looking to lose weight, then just set small goals for yourself. You can use BMI as a guideline, but maybe set a goal of say 150 for yourself or something. Eat healthy, exercise, etc. BMI is good for only guidelines.
